Dear Michael - no date.( in France )
Hope you had a nice Xmas, it didn't sound too bad by our letter. Hope you are keeping warm. It sounds like you are having an interesting time if not too luxurious. I trust you are free from colds at least you don't get foggy weather there ( or shouldn't ) I am writing this without my specs and am finding it rather difficult. Barbara is keeping well , putting on some weight. It seems "Cissie" Clark is "preggers" too about the same time. John has been very queer all over Xmas, and couldn't touch his dinner, has been living on satzumas and oranges. However he has slowly recovered and is back at work. Hope you enjoy the paper, all I could get. Love from Mum xxx
